The Beam Line Emulator (BLE) is a 5-axis tilt head attachment designed exclusively for the XR12 CNC Rotary Cutter. It brings beamline-class capabilities — coping, beveling, drilling, layout marking, and complex end-prep — to a single machine that fits in your existing shop footprint.
Traditional beam lines are purpose-built, multi-station systems that can cost hundreds of thousands of dollars and consume significant floor space. The BLE delivers the same core workflow on your XR12 — at a fraction of the cost, with zero additional footprint.
Paired with JD2's GCmaker software, the BLE imports industry-standard NC1, STEP, IGES, and DXF files directly from your detailing software, automatically generating toolpaths for structural steel profiles. No manual layout. No guesswork.

The BLE's 5-axis tilt head gives the torch full angular access to structural profiles. This means complex copes, compound bevels, and angled end-prep that would normally require multiple setups on different machines — done in a single pass on the XR12.
The tilt head is the key to unlocking beamline-style operations. It enables the torch to follow the geometry of I-beams, channels, and angle — reaching flanges and webs that a standard vertical torch simply cannot.
GCmaker is JD2's purpose-built software for the BLE attachment. It imports industry-standard NC1 files — the same files your steel detailer already produces — and automatically generates optimized toolpaths for every operation: cuts, copes, bolt holes, layout marks, and bevels.
No manual programming. No G-code editing. Import the file, verify the preview, and run. GCmaker handles the translation between your detailing model and the XR12's motion system.
